    We all hope he gets the maximum penalty, but if he doesn't, we can be pretty confident that his career in medicine is in serious jeopardy. Unlikely his hospital (Beverly Hospital in Montebello) will support him with a criminal conviction. Any other hospital he may apply to, once his sentence is served, will look at his record. If there are any avid cyclists on the Credentials Committee (which approves hospital privileges for staff physicians) they will never let him on staff.

    Finally, I can't imagine he will get medical malpractice insurance, he can't be impartial in treating cyclists injured in accidents. So, the trouble is just beginning for the future career of Dr. Christopher Thompson. Check in with the Medical Board of California in a month or two to see if his license has been revoked.
